I'm thinking about getting another motobecane, I loved that bike so much even as a regular pedal bike it was the nicest bike I've ever owned.

I'd probably do another gebe wheel/custom motor mount, but with a bigger displacement engine and geared for more torque.

V1 had a 27cc I built from the ground up and a 14t pinion cog. V2 will have my ported/piped 43cc and an 11/12 t pinion with a belt tensioner that helps the belt contact mor of the pinion cog "that V1 lacked" so it can climb better than my axle mount setup. It has a 5:1 trans, 11:44 gearing, for an actual 20:1 final drive ratio.

The gebe sheave has a virtual tooth count of two seventy something? I can't remember?

I'll go do my gearing calculations and start saving for a $800+ motobecane and a $200 velocity wheel.
